Output 66d32cae3d56e5e70da36145fdc2812d13f4cd868cc803f8ae65a8b4e869acbe:8

value
1412000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 453c6bc580ce8a81347eba620243458f3cc51cde OP_EQUAL
address
9xkMfkRZ6Sn4XWehjMDFRkHF69Zv69fde2
transaction
66d32cae3d56e5e70da36145fdc2812d13f4cd868cc803f8ae65a8b4e869acbe